This is not a new installation. I was running SGEN Tcode. I stopped the transaction and wanted to start it again, it gave an ABAP DUMP error. After that i had restarted the Server at OS level. From then onwards the TNS Listener service was not starting.
But the problem is resolved. The problem was with the IP Address. It was changed and the entry was not present in the Host file. So i have made an entry in the hostfile and started the TNS Listener service, it worked.

  • Oracle 11g XE listener does not start automatically during boot

    Hi,
    This happened to me recently I just wanted to share it with you.
    For development I was running Standard Edition, at some point I decided to run also XE on the same server for another reasons. Everything was working fine, except that after restart of the server, the XE listener is not starting automatically. Debugging the startup script I found that this happens because of a bug in the code, which assumes that XE listener is running if it finds the word LISTENER within the processes list. I didn't found any obligation in the docs for running XE without any other databases on the same host.
    In file /etc/init.d/oracle-xe, at line 556 the code is failing:
    1     + status='oracle 2889 1 0 May13 ? 00:00:05 /oracle/ora112se/bin/tnslsnr LISTENER -inherit'
    2     + '[' 'oracle 2889 1 0 May13 ? 00:00:05 /oracle/ora112se/bin/tnslsnr LISTENER -inherit' == '' ']'
    As you can see I have another listener(the one for SE) running and because of the XE startup script found the keyword LISTENER it’s supposing that the XE LISTENER is already running.
    To fix this simply change line 556 from:
    1     status=`ps -ef | grep tns | grep oracle`
    To:
    1     status=`ps -ef | grep tns | grep oracle | grep xe`
    Now XE listener is started automatically during boot.

    "ServiceAliasException: Could not save Service Alias:
    TNS-04415: File i/o error  caused by: java.io.FileNotFoundException:
    $PATH;ORACLE_HOME\network\admin\tnsnames.ora (The system cannot find the path specified)"
    Your TNS_ADMIN setting is messed up.
    $PATH is a Unix style environment variable reference - isn't going to work on Windows. I'm not even sure you can do a list of directories to search in the TNS_ADMIN variable.
    Check the value set in HKLM/Software/Oracle/youroraclehomename ... Set it explicitly to the location of your tnsnames.ora file.
    You normally don't need a listener.ora file at all ... Rename it and see what happens.
